Balance Transfer Fee
The balance transfer fee is an important consideration when choosing a credit card. The Bread Cashback American Express Credit Card charges either $10 or 5% of the amount of each transfer, whichever is greater.
This fee can add up quickly, so it's essential to understand how it works. For example, if you transfer $2,000, the fee would be $100 (5% of $2,000).
It's worth noting that this fee is not unique to the Bread Cashback American Express Credit Card, but it's something to consider when deciding whether to transfer a balance.

American Express Drawbacks
The Bread Cashback American Express Credit Card has some drawbacks you should consider. No signup bonus is offered, which means you won't get a one-time incentive for signing up.
The card also lacks a 0% intro APR, which can be a big deal if you need to make a large purchase or transfer a balance. This can save you money in interest charges, but with this card, you'll have to pay the regular APR from the start.
The APR on this card is potentially high, with a variable rate starting at 20.74%. This is higher than the industry average of 16%, which means you could end up paying more in interest over time.
